2022-08-22 “carried away unto these dumb idols”

I Corinthians 12:2  “Ye know that ye were Gentiles, carried away unto these dumb idols, even as ye were led.  3  Wherefore I give you to understand, that no man speaking by the Spirit of God calleth Jesus accursed: and that no man can say that Jesus is the Lord, but by the Holy Ghost.

Even without regeneration, Spiritual Birth the human brain seems to have been wired to worship something in some form.  The Gentiles had been “led”, taught to worship “dumb idols”.  Even in our present day, there remains a wide variety of idolatry, different peoples around the world all worshiping different things.  Each system has its own disciplines, moral codes, ceremonies, allegiances, and penalties.  There are common features in all systems of idolatry that are made vivid in Daniel Chapter One.  Their images are either human or are manmade, their images are magnificent and attractive figures to look upon, they receive noble sanction by authorities, there is an aura of authority and command, carnally attractive music is used, everything is under man’s control and choregraphed to be attractive to human senses, and there is a significant element of fear (Daniel 3:1-6).  In several cases in history, national leaders have been deified, and worshiped in a national cult; the followers of such cults are so bound to their deity that the people willingly give their lives in his service and for his cause.  As in the case of the Jewish leaders, they even made an idol of God’s Law.  They had all the regimen of religion, but it was all in vain, for the Lord told them that “ye believe not, because ye are not of my sheep, as I said unto you” (John 10:26).  Even the Apostle Paul had been brought up under such a regimen, being taught the discipline of religion, the practice of religion, the fear of religion, etc.  But, it was all in a carnal sense until the Lord Himself spoke to him, giving Him Spiritual Life (Acts 9:3-9).  Paul later wrote that he had been “brought up in this city at the feet of Gamaliel, and taught according to the perfect manner of the law of the fathers” (Acts 22:3); but, at that time it was simply an attractive regimen to follow for advancement.  But, the Lord Changed him completely when He gave him Spiritual Birth.  In our day, as the Word of God is being rejected and pushed aside in our country; all kinds of wicked groups, gangs, unsavory organizations, etc. are rising up and binding people to them, often with very wicked intent.  Let us, as the Corinthians did, simply preach, teach, live, and rejoice in Jesus Christ even as “the heathen rage, and the people imagine a vain thing” (Psalms 2:1).  For they worship “dumb idols”; but we worship the “living God” (II Corinthians 6:16)!
